Submarine cable umbilical bend restrictors are essential components designed to prevent excessive bending and mechanical damage in subsea cables and umbilicals. By enforcing a safe bending radius, they ensure long-term integrity and performance under high pressure, dynamic loads, and harsh marine conditions.

How Bend Restrictors Work

Bend restrictors operate by physically limiting the cable’s bending radius to a predefined safe value. They consist of interlocking segments or a flexible sleeve that guides the cable along a smooth, controlled curve. This design:

  • Absorbs and distributes external forces caused by currents, waves, and vessel motion

  • Prevents sharp bends that could damage conductors, insulation, or optical fibers

  • Maintains signal integrity and power transmission reliability in dynamic subsea settings

Key Materials: Why Polyurethane?

Polyurethane is the material of choice for high-performance bend restrictors due to its:

  • Excellent abrasion and impact resistance

  • High flexibility across a wide temperature range

  • Strong resistance to seawater, UV exposure, and chemicals

  • Long service life in depths exceeding 3000 meters

Installation Guidelines

Proper installation is crucial for effective bend restriction. Key steps include:

  • Positioning the restrictor at critical stress points: cable hang-offs, J-tube exits, and touchdown zones

  • Assembling modular segments around the cable or umbilicals

  • Securing the system using bolts, clamps, or straps to prevent slippage

  • Ensuring full contact and alignment with the cable throughout its length

Performance Under Extreme Conditions

Bend restrictors are engineered to perform in demanding subsea environments, with capabilities including:

  • Pressure resistance: up to 300 bar or more

  • Operating temperature range: -4°C to 40°C (and customized options available)

  • Fatigue resistance under cyclic loading from tides and vessel motion

  • Compatibility with dynamic and static cable systems

Industry Applications

Bend restrictors are widely used across marine industries to protect critical subsea infrastructure:

  • Oil & Gas:Protecting umbilicals for power, control, and chemical injection lines

  • Offshore Wind:Securing inter-array and export cables

  • Subsea Mining & Marine Research:Supporting power and data transmission systems

  • Telecommunications:Safeguarding submarine fiber optic cables
